Picture this - 1978, 3:00 a.m. on a school night.  I'm living in Novato, CA, about 35 miles north of Burlingame, just south of San Francisco. I get a call - do you own a tan '66 VW sedan?  yeah, (thru the haze) - did you loan it to anyone?  Uh, no, but I have a few questions for you - who is this, what time is it, and why are you asking?  This is the Burlingame police, it's 3:00 in the morning and we have your car here with four teenagers.  Call your local police and file a complaint - here are their names - blah, blah, blah, and Blah.
 
Novato police come - I tell them that blah, blah, and - - - - One officer interrupts me and gives me the other two names.  Hmmmmmm. 
 
Two 16 y/o girls, one 17 y/o male and one 18 y/o male.  They hot wired the car and were joy riding about.  Police said they stopped them for a "tail light" violation.  At the hearing - the fathers of the two girls were busy doing paper work (no cell phones or computers then) and hardly paid any attention to the proceedings.  The young male was not represented that I could see.  Later in S.F. court, the 18 male perp was shackled and trudged out - ordered to make restitution for damages (window and headliner) and time served.  I did get a check for the full amount.
 
The notorious little joy riders are now about 50 years old.  Wonder what ever happened to them - - wonder if they are alive?
